Answer. Lightning heats the air in its path and causes a large over-pressure of the air within its channel. Thunder Fun Facts. The channel expands supersonically into the surrounding air as a shock wave and creates an acoustic signal that is heard as thunder. If you can hear thunder, lightning is nearby. A negative charge forms at the base of the cloud where the hail collects, while the lighter ice crystals remain near the top of the cloud and create a positive charge.The negative charge is attracted to the Earth's surface and other clouds and objects. (n.d.) reported that the sounds of thunder fall into categories based on Inversion thunder results when lightning strikes between cloud and ground occur during a temperature inversion; the resulting thunder sound have significantly greater acoustic energy than from the same distance in a non-inversion condition. Within a temperature inversion, the sound energy is prevented from dispersing vertically as it would in a non-inversion and is thus concentrated in the near-ground layer.Cloud-ground lightning typically consist of two or more return strokes, from ground to cloud.
